Dolav aces tests

TÜV SÜD has been putting the Dolav Ace to the test. The independent test body has dropped, crushed, spiked and rotated the plastic pallet box, which is claimed to have outperformed other, apparently similar, products.

According to Dolav, best ‘price-for-spec’ does not tell the real life’ story, and not all products are ‘abuse ready’ for real-world recycling tasks like the Dolav Ace.

For example, at Mosley Waste Management, Simon Mosley has a simple solution to mechanically handling food waste. “If we use IBCs they only last two or three months if we are lucky, but a Dolav Ace lasts for years, it only costs about twice the price of an IBC and we can sell used Dolavs years later, still in good condition, for the same as an IBC costs.”
